What “speed” really means

Speed has three dimensions:

  • Throughput — how much you complete in a given time (tasks finished, distance run, pages read).
  • Latency — how quickly you respond or start a task (reaction time, decision time).
  • Sustainable pace — how long you can maintain speed without burnout or error.

A Speed Wizard optimizes all three: finishing more, starting faster, and keeping a reliable pace.


Mindset and foundations

  1. Clarify outcomes, not activities
    Speed comes from doing the right things. Define the minimal outcome that delivers value (the “minimum viable result”), then work backward. Ask: what deliverable truly matters? Trim or defer everything else.

  2. Embrace deliberate practice
    Fast results require focused practice. Use time-blocked sessions with specific sub-goals and immediate feedback. Short, intense practice beats long, unfocused work.

  3. Optimize for learning speed, not just performance speed
    When learning a skill, prioritize techniques that improve your learning curve: spaced repetition, varied practice, and feedback loops. This yields faster long-term gains.


Environment and tools

  1. Design a low-friction workspace
    Remove obstacles that add seconds or minutes: place tools within reach, automate repetitive setup steps, and reduce cognitive switching costs (single-purpose screens, minimal open tabs).

  2. Automate predictable work
    Identify repetitive tasks and automate them with scripts, templates, or macros. Automation multiplies speed across repeated cycles.

  3. Use friction intentionally
    For tasks that benefit from slower deliberation (big decisions, creative work), add a small amount of friction (a wait period, accountability check). For routine tasks, remove friction completely.


Time management hacks

  1. Time-box and use the Pomodoro principle
    Work in focused sprints (e.g., 25–50 minutes) followed by short breaks. This raises effective concentration and reduces fatigue.

  2. Prioritize high-impact work with the ⁄20 rule
    Identify the 20% of tasks producing 80% of results. Attack those first when energy and attention are highest.

  3. Batch similar tasks
    Group email replies, meetings, or creative tasks into single blocks to avoid context-switching costs that dramatically slow you down.


Cognitive speed hacks

  1. Reduce decision fatigue
    Use defaults and pre-made rules for recurring choices (e.g., a standard meeting agenda, a wardrobe rotation). Save decision energy for novel problems.

  2. Use templates and mental models
    Mental models (first principles, inversion, marginal gains) let you approach problems faster. Templates structure output so you spend less time reinventing formats.

  3. Practice rapid prototyping
    Build quick drafts, tests, or experiments to validate ideas before polishing. Fast iteration uncovers problems earlier and avoids wasted effort.


Physical and neurological boosters

  1. Sleep and circadian alignment
    Prioritize consistent sleep. Reaction time, memory consolidation, and decision-making speed all suffer when sleep-deprived.

  2. Nutrition and hydration
    Stable blood glucose and hydration sustain cognitive performance. Prefer protein-rich breakfasts, steady snacks, and water over long caffeinated binges.

  3. Micro-movements and power naps
    Short walks or 10–20 minute naps can reset focus and speed. Move between focused sessions to sustain peak performance.


Communication and collaboration

  1. Make meetings shorter and outcome-driven
    Set clear objectives, a tight agenda, and a decision at the end. Invite only necessary participants and use a “parking lot” for tangential topics.

  2. Use concise status updates
    Structure updates in three lines: context, what changed, and next steps. This reduces back-and-forth and keeps teams aligned.

  3. Give fast feedback
    Rapid, specific feedback shortens learning cycles and prevents errors from compounding.


Physical speed and athletic tips (if improving bodily speed)

  1. Warm up dynamically
    Prepare the nervous system with movement-specific drills to improve reaction and acceleration.

  2. Focus on technique first
    Efficient form reduces wasted energy and increases speed. Use video analysis or a coach to correct small inefficiencies.

  3. Interval training and specificity
    Sprint intervals, resisted sprints, and sport-specific drills improve maximal speed and speed endurance faster than long slow sessions.


Risk management and quality control

  1. Build quick quality checks
    Short, frequent inspections catch errors early. A 5-minute QA routine after a sprint prevents rework that erodes effective speed.

  2. Limit scope when uncertain
    When knowledge is limited, shrink the scope and run fast experiments. Expand only after validation.

  3. Know when to slow down
    For high-consequence decisions (legal, safety, large investments), impose deliberate pause points to consult experts or run simulations.


Daily routine of a Speed Wizard (example)

  • Morning (start of day): 20–30 min planning — pick top 3 priorities.
  • First work block: 60–90 min deep work on priority #1 (no meetings).
  • Midday: short walk, protein lunch, 20 min learning/skill practice.
  • Afternoon: batch communications and low-intensity tasks; a 20-min focused sprint on priority #2.
  • End of day: 10–15 min review — note wins, blockers, and next-day priorities.

Tools and resources to support speed

  • Task managers with priorities and time estimates (e.g., Todo apps that support time-boxing)
  • Automation: macros, Zapier/Make, shell scripts, text expansion tools
  • Learning tools: spaced-repetition apps, interval trainers, code kata platforms
  • Communication: shared docs with templates, meeting timers, async video updates

Common pitfalls and how to avoid them

  • Chasing speed over accuracy — build in micro-checks.
  • Over-automation without oversight — review automated outputs periodically.
  • Speed as busyness — measure outcomes, not activity.
  • Ignoring recovery — schedule rest like any critical resource.
